Falcon River is an ordained Dianic Priestess of the Guardian Path, dedicated to a magical partnership model that collaborates with other ritual facilitators to insure a safe and powerful ritual experience for participants. She has helped create and support women’s ritual circles since 1976 and is passionately committed to teaching practical energetic and magical skills for daily life. In 1999, Falcon co-founded Temple of Diana with Ruth Barrett, where she taught on the core faculty for The Spiral Door Women’s Mystery School of Magick and Ritual Arts for fifteen years. Falcon grew up in the Appalachian mountains of southern West Virginia, climbing the trees and crawling into every cave she could find. As a child, she was trained in traditional folk magic and medicine by her family elders. In her early 30s, Falcon studied and apprenticed intensively with Dr. Dawna Markova, author of The Open Mind, a body of work dealing with perceptual learning modalities. Falcon also studied for several years with Linda Tellington-Jones and Robin Hood, learning the Tellington Touch/TEAM Techniques for working with horses and other companion animals in their healing and training. For more than 30 years, she was a professional bodyworker, healer, and clairvoyant working with animals and people. Falcon is also a storyteller, a traditional archer and has brought “Amazon Archery” to women’s festivals and Pagan gatherings for decades as a tool for empowerment. She continues to teach online, do healing work, leather crafting and woodworking from her home with wife, Ruth Barrett in Michigan. Falcon has been teaching the Elder Futhark runes for about 40 years, bringing a female-centered perspective to her students online and at festivals nationally.Falcon River was a major interviewee for Baby, You’re My Religion: Women, Gay Bars, and Theology Before Stonewall, by Marie Cartier, Ph.D., (2013, Routledge) She was also an interviewee for Ruth Barrett’s Women’s Rites, Women’s Mysteries: Intuitive Ritual Creation (3rd Edition, Tidal Time Publishing, LLC, 2018). She contributed a chapter entitled “The Bathroom” to the anthology, Female Erasure: What You Need To Know About Gender Politics’ War On Women, the Female Sex and Human Rights (Tidal Time Publishing, 2016) She is also included in Feminists Who Changed America 1963-1975, editor Barbara J.
